Responsibilities Represent Sodexo at our very large client site, working with all marketing programs for our Food Service offering. Drive guest/client experience through social media marketing campaigns; direct guest experience surveys; and help to create visual media/marketing campaigns to showcase the Sodexo brand. Be hands-on with all visitors to the site to create a fun guest experience. Oversee the retail offers, retail systems, vending services and execution of the on-site retail/vending strategy. Support and coach, develop and oversee the retail team. Use innovation to create and maintain cutting-edge offerings, ensuring innovative solutions and technology are maximized. Contribute to and execute on segment Go-To-Market strategies related to retail and vending initiatives. Operationalize and oversee the local annual segment retail and vending marketing plans, including digital and online marketing campaigns and promotions. Assess the suitability of offerings for the audience and operationalize programs and initiatives. Act as a Subject Matter Expert on retail initiatives, programs, technology, and systems. Ensure consistency across retail operations and with the segment overall. Engage in the sales and RFP processes for new and renewal business. Provide solution/offer development support, targeted marketing campaigns, build proposals, budget options, validate equipment lists and pricing, and participate in presentations (written, visuals and in person) for new and renewal retail/vending business. Qualifications Bachelors degree or diploma in business, marketing, communications or food and nutrition. 5 years industry experience managing food portfolios including multiple brands and sites. 3 years management experience, supervising people and programs. Food Safe level 1 and 2. Experience with innovative marketing, digital technology platforms and communications strategies an asset. Strong presentation skills. Financial management skills including budgeting, understanding of operational expenses and brand financial management. Partnership experience with external brands and brand management experience. Experience in negotiations an asset. Strong experience working with Excel, Word, PowerPoint, email.
